- CClareLondon •9 reviews4.0Dined 5 days agoWe came for afternoon tea - it is a stunning setting with a lovely ambience. Our waitress couldn't have been more welcoming or attentive - I wish I knew her name as she was wonderful. A little disappointed there was no non-alcohol "fizz" ion offer in place of champagne (other places sometimes offer a chilled sparkling tea for example), although I'm aware there were some non-alcoholic cocktails on the wider bar menu. The food arrived, beautifully presented and plentiful - our waitress explained everything we had (and she had checked for allergies at the start so that thoughtful adjustments had been made to my companion's sandwich selection) - she also said that additional sandwiches could be obtained on request. The sandwiches were nice, the bread a little dry in places as if they had been out for a little while before arriving at our table, but not too unpleasant to eat. We did both request a single extra sandwich but this took so long to arrive we had already proceeded to our scones and rather lost our appetite for the sandwiches! The scones with jam and clotted cream were delightful - I could not manage two, and then struggled to eat 2 of the 4 stunning cakes on the top tier, but our waitress provided a takeaway box so that we were able to take home the uneaten items (my family enjoyed these!). Overall I would say it was a good experience, I would certainly revisit The Ned again, and at £50 a head, it is a reasonably priced afternoon tea - not as good as Fortnum's or The Lanesborough (but not nearly as expensive either). We had a very pleasant afternoon - the ambience was relaxed and the staff friendly. Just a few small touches as mentioned would make it perfect, but I would recommend to others for a reasonably priced afternoon tea in the City.
